Change reply to address in Office 365

I have a new user to whom we've giving a user logon and email address that conforms to our standard. However, because of her position, she'd prefer it to have all of her last name. I have attempted to add that new address and set it to the reply address in EAC, but I get an error message that I can't do that because it's being synced with our on-premise environment. We do have AD locally and we're still in a hybrid mode, although her email box is in the O365 cloud. I found an article that said I needed to change the Proxyaddresses in AD. So I went there and added the new email address with the SMTP tag instead of smtp and I save it. Enough time has passed so that it should have synced. However, I still do not see it in the EAC for her mailbox and if I try and make the change, I still get the same error.  Is there  away I can do this without tearing down her whole account and rebuilding it?
